PCE Test Questions with Complete
Solutions 2024/2025

Functional movement screen - ANSWERSMSK, 7 exercises, sport/athletic population. Squat, stepping,
lunge, SLR, push up, bird-dog, back scratch



Hip injury and OA outcome score - ANSWERSMSK, self-reported questionnaire



knee injury and OA outcome score - ANSWERSMSK, self-reported questionnaire



Lower extremity functional scale (LEFS) - ANSWERSMSK, patient rated outcome measure - measures
perceived difficulty with tasks



McGill pain questionnaire - ANSWERSMSK, self-reported, quality and intensity of pain - subjective



numeric pain rating scale - ANSWERSMSK, 0-10 rating of pain



Oswestry disability index - ANSWERSMSK, low back pain disability index, patient-reported ADL difficulty



Rolan Morris Disability Questionnaire - ANSWERSMSK, low back pain and disability, patient reported



Visual analogue scale - ANSWERSMSK

-0-10: describes pain.

-"faces" pain scale: 0-5



Borg breathlessness scale - ANSWERSMSK

0-10

Remember it goes: 0, 0.5, 1, 2, 3, ... 10

, Modified MRC dyspnea scale - ANSWERSCRP

grade 0-4

0: no trouble except for with strenuous exercise

4: too breathless to leave house



Barthel - ANSWERSneuro

Measures performance in ADLs, PT measured, ordinal scale (measurement that reports the ranking and
ordering of the data without actually establishing the degree of variation between them)



Box and blocks test - ANSWERSneuro, unilateral gross manual dexterity



Chedoke-McMaster stroke ax - ANSWERSneuro, screening and ax tool to measure physical impairment
and activity, functional mobility, impairment and activity inventory



DASH - ANSWERSneuro, disabilities of arm, shoulder, hand. 30-item self reported questionnaire, ability
to certain UE activities



Disability rating scale (DRS) - ANSWERSneuro, rate effects of injury and decide how long recovery might
take

Moderate-severe TBI



Dizziness handicap inventory - ANSWERSneuro, 25-item self-reported questionnaire quantifying dizziness
on daily life activities



dizziness handicap inventory - ANSWERSneuro, 25 item self reported questionnaire quantifying dizziness
on daily life activities



expanded disability status scale - ANSWERSneuro, method to quantify disability in MS. Monitors changes
in level of disability over time. 0-10, but measures every 0.5
